You don't need any app, although you could probably find dozens by searching 'comprehensible input' on YouTube. Comprehensible Input is achieved by watching and reading the content you enjoy in your target language and rely on context to understand and acquire it . Here are some tips:
Learn the bare minimum vocabulary needed to have a general understanding of what's being said. Words such as conjunctions (and, but, etc.), prepositions (under, above, in, out, etc.), adverbs (fast, often, very, etc.), interrogatives (how, when, who, etc.), important adjectives (colors, tall, short, etc.), and the 100 most used verbs (be, have, want, do,say, go etc.). The goal is to later acquire new words from context.
At first, you will not be able to understand new words from context alone most of the time , so you'll need to check the dictionary very often. Over time, you'll rely on context more and more.
Depending on the target language, you don't need to focus much on grammar, but don't omit it completely. It's easier to just learn why the sentence is the way it is, than to slowly memorize the correct structure.
Mastering a language is a long process. Depending on how far or close your target language is to your native one, it'll probably take you from 6 months to 2 years to acquire enough of the language where you'll unlock the full potential of passive learning and you'll slowly master your target language by just consuming the media of said language.
I highly recommend using Nova video player. It's an android video player specifically made to handle movies and series. It's got everything you neeed from automatically downloading each movie /episode poster, description, subtitles, got audio boost and night mode. And oh, I almost forgot to say that it's an open source project and it's available on f-droid.
